Finance Review Summary — Customer Concentration, Verelux Group

Revenue concentration remains elevated: the Dunmoor account represents 31% of recurring income, up from 26% last year. Two further accounts together add 18%. Contract renewal timing clusters in the second quarter, compounding exposure. Heads of department should factor this into hiring and inventory commitments. Mitigation options are under review, and the confidential note below sets out the plan.

internal memo for faweg-hahip: Silokix Works plans to lower the Tamvan list price by 8 percent in June.

## Ferngate Environments — Canary Gating

When reviewing changes to Ferngate's deploy pipeline, keep the canary gating rules in mind. Every release passes through staging, then a 5% canary in production. The gate promotes automatically only if error rate, p99 latency, and saturation all stay within thresholds for the full bake window; any single breach halts promotion and pages the owning team. Manual overrides require two approvers. Threshold changes must be reflected in the gating config, reproduced below for reference.

service settings:
[pelius]
port = 5432
team = praius
host = pelius.crelvoforge.internal
region = upper-4
access_code = ac_8f224d
timeout_ms = 2000

UserSplit Cutover Drift: the extracted account service and the legacy Marigold monolith user module are reporting divergent record counts during dual-write. This fires when drift exceeds 0.5% over 15 minutes. New team members should not replay writes manually. Reconciliation steps and the rollback procedure are documented on the internal page.

wiki page, tajog-fafog: https://gitlab.paliqsys.corp/dash/display/job/853dd6fcbf54